HTML Leerzeichen: Der umfassende Leitfaden zu HTML Leerzeichen, Auszeichnungstipps und praktischen Anwendungen

Pre

In der Welt des Webdesigns spielen HTML Leerzeichen eine entscheidende Rolle für Textfluss, Lesbarkeit und Layout. Obwohl Browser automatisch Leerzeichen zu einem gewissen Grad zusammenfassen, bieten speziell codierte Zeichen und Strategien die Kontrolle, die für saubere Texte, klare Strukturen und barrierefreie Inhalte unerlässlich ist. Dieser Leitfaden erklärt detailliert, was HTML Leerzeichen bedeuten, wie sie funktionieren und wie man sie gezielt einsetzt – von einfachen Textblöcken bis hin zu komplexen Layouts.

HTML Leerzeichen verstehen: Grundprinzipien und Hintergründe

HTML Leerzeichen sind mehr als nur sichtbare Zeichen. Sie definieren, wie Text innerhalb von HTML-Elementen gebrochen, ausgerichtet und gerendert wird. Die Basistegmente sind normale Leerzeichen ( SPACE ), die in der Quelltextdatei geschrieben werden, sowie deren spezielle Entitäten wie   (non-breaking space),   (en-space) und   (em-space). In der Praxis bedeutet das: Wenn Sie in HTML schreiben, dass Text durch ein einzelnes Leerzeichen getrennt wird, wird dies in der Regel so angezeigt, als ob mehrere Leerzeichen zusammengefasst würden. Das passiert, weil HTML standardmäßig mehrere aufeinanderfolgende Leerzeichen ignoriert.

Was sind HTML Leerzeichen: Von normalen Zeichen bis zu speziellen Entitäten

HTML Leerzeichen umfassen mehrere Typen, die je nach Anwendungsfall unterschiedliche Effekte erzeugen. Die gängigsten sind:

  • Normales Leerzeichen (Space) – das Standardzeichen, das in HTML-Quelltext auftaucht und im Renderingsystem zu einem einzelnen Abstand führt.
  •   – Non-breaking Space, der verhindert, dass der Text am Zeilenende getrennt wird. Ideal, um zusammengehörige Wörter oder Zahlen zusammenzuhalten.
  •   – En-space, etwas breiter als das normale Leerzeichen, oft genutzt, um Auseinanderhaltung innerhalb von Maßeinheiten oder in bestimmten typografischen Layouts zu erzeugen.
  •   – Em-space, größer als das En-Space, häufig verwendet, um Abschnitte optisch zu strukturieren oder Indentation zu simulieren.
  •   – Thin Space, ein sehr schmales Leerzeichen, das in mathematischen Formeln oder feinen Typografie-Kontexten nützlich ist.

Zusätzlich gibt es andere Entitäten wie  ;  (geschützter Bindestrich mit Leerzeichen) und verschiedene Unicode-Zeichen, die das Layout-Verhalten beeinflussen. In der Praxis spielt html leerzeichen eine zentrale Rolle, wenn Sie Textfluss, Kompositionalität und Lesbarkeit als Designer oder Entwickler sicherstellen möchten.

HTML Leerzeichen vs. CSS: Wie sich Textlayout wirklich steuern lässt

Die Art, wie HTML Leerzeichen gerendert werden, hängt auch von CSS-Eigenschaften ab. Mit der Eigenschaft white-space kann der Textfluss stark beeinflusst werden. Mögliche Werte sind normal, nowrap, pre, pre-wrap und pre-line. Diese Einstellungen bestimmen, ob und wie Zeilenumbrüche, Seitenumbrüche und Leerzeichen beibehalten oder ignoriert werden. Wenn Sie gezielt HTML Leerzeichen in Ihrem Layout benötigen, können Sie diese CSS-Verstärkungen nutzen, um Präzision zu erreichen – etwa um Phrasen optisch zu trennen oder in Tabellenköpfen Abstände konsistent zu halten.

Umsatz der Begrifflichkeiten: HTML Leerzeichen in Überschriften, Absätzen und Listen

In Überschriften und Absätzen zeigt sich der praktische Unterschied zwischen normalen Leerzeichen und den speziellen Entitäten. In Überschriften ist es üblich, normale Leerzeichen zu verwenden, um Lesbarkeit zu bewahren. In Tabellenzellen, Code-Blöcken oder fest formatierten Bereichen kann ein non-breaking Space sinnvoll sein, um Wortpaare zusammenzuhalten. Achten Sie bei der Verwendung von html leerzeichen darauf, dass Suchmaschinen-Crawler den Inhalt korrekt interpretieren können – zu viele spezielle Zeichen können die Lesbarkeit beeinträchtigen, sollten aber dort eingesetzt werden, wo sie tatsächlich semantisch sinnvoll sind.

Typische Einsatzgebiete für HTML Leerzeichen

Textfluss in Fließtexten und Layouts

Im Fließtext wird das normale Leerzeichen am häufigsten genutzt. Doch in bestimmten Fällen, wie bei Datum- oder Zahlenformaten (z. B. 1 234 statt 1,234 in deutschsprachigen Texten) kann die gezielte Nutzung von   Sinn machen, um zu verhindern, dass Trennlinien mitten in einer Zahl entstehen.

Typografische Feinheiten mit   und  

En- und Em-Space helfen, Abstand innerhalb von Layout-Komponenten konsistent zu gestalten, ohne auf CSS zurückgreifen zu müssen. Besonders in Logos, Namen oder Codesegmenten, die in einer Zeile stehen sollen, können diese Entitäten ein konsistentes Erscheinungsbild schaffen.

Non-breaking Space in Namen, Adressen und Telefonnummern

  wird häufig verwendet, um Zeilenumbrüche zwi­schen zusammengehörigen Informationen (z. B. Vorname und Nachname, Stadt und Postleitzahl) zu verhindern. Achten Sie darauf, dass Sie eine logische Semantik beibehalten; der Einsatz sollte den Lesefluss verbessern, nicht verhindern, dass der Text unvermittelt umbrechen muss.

Häufige Fehler mit HTML Leerzeichen und wie man sie vermeidet

Obwohl HTML Leerzeichen mächtig sind, passieren oft einfache Fehler, die zu unvorhergesehenen Layout-Problemen führen. Hier sind gängige Fallstricke und wie man sie löst:

  • Zu viele Non-breaking Spaces in Folge können zu unnatürlichen Abständen führen. Verwenden Sie   nur dort, wo echte Nicht-Trennbarkeit nötig ist.
  • Wenn Sie CSS white-space: nowrap konsequent verwenden, sollten Sie sicherstellen, dass der Inhalt dennoch sinnvoll lesbar bleibt, insbesondere auf mobilen Geräten.
  • Bei Übersetzungen oder mehrsprachigen Inhalten beachten Sie, dass typografische Regeln je Sprache variieren – HTML Leerzeichen müssen international konsistent interpretiert werden.
  • Verwechseln Sie nicht Leerzeichen mit Trennstrichen oder Satzzeichen; sie erfüllen unterschiedliche Funktionen in Semantik und Layout.

HTML Leerzeichen und Suchmaschinenoptimierung (SEO)

SEO-Experten raten dazu, Text für Menschen lesbar zu halten und die Struktur von HTML sauber zu halten. HTML Leerzeichen beeinflussen die Lesbarkeit zwar indirekt, aber sie können die Bedeutung von Absätzen, Listen und Überschriften stärken. Verwenden Sie HTML Leerzeichen bewusst, um sinnvolle Akzente zu setzen, ohne die Struktur zu überladen. Suchmaschinen-Crawler analysieren primär Semantik und hierarchische Struktur; dennoch tragen klare Abstände in Überschriften und Absätzen zu einer besseren Nutzererfahrung bei, was indirekt positive Signale senden kann. In Bezug auf das keyword html leerzeichen ist es sinnvoll, die Begriffe natürlich in den Textfluss zu integrieren, ohne Keyword-Stuffing zu betreiben.

Praktische Tipps zur richtigen Handhabung von HTML Leerzeichen in HTML-Editoren

Die Praxis in Editoren wie Visual Studio Code, Sublime Text oder HTML-Editoren der Web-Entwicklung bedarf einer klaren Strategie. Hier sind hilfreiche Tipps, um HTML Leerzeichen gezielt einzusetzen:

  • Nutzen Sie Non-breaking Spaces sparsam, vor allem in Tabellen, Kreditkarten- oder Personendaten, um Daten nicht versehentlich umbrechen zu lassen.
  • Dokumentieren Sie Ihre Entscheidungen: Ein Kommentar in Ihrem HTML, warum ein   in einem bestimmten Kontext notwendig ist, erleichtert späteren Wartungsaufwand.
  • Testen Sie in mehreren Browsern und Endgeräten, wie der Textfluss mit HTML Leerzeichen dargestellt wird. Unterschiede in Rendering-Engines können auftreten.
  • Nutzen Sie CSS, um komplexe Abstände zu definieren, statt ausschließlich HTML Entitäten zu verwenden, wenn möglich. Das erhöht die Wartbarkeit und Einheitlichkeit des Layouts.

Beispiele: Praktische Anwendung von HTML Leerzeichen

Beispiel 1: Datum und Uhrzeit in einer Zeile

Wenn Sie Datum und Uhrzeit in einer Zeile präsentieren möchten, kann ein   zwischen Tag, Monat und Jahr sinnvoll sein, um zu verhindern, dass sich diese miteinander trennen. So bleibt „12. März 2025 14:30 Uhr“ zusammen.

Beispiel 2: Namen in einer Zeile

Bei einer Namenszeile wie „Max Mustermann“ kann ein   zwischen Vor- und Nachname verhindern, dass der Name am Ende einer Zeile getrennt wird. Beachten Sie, dass in Überschriften hier oft normale Leerzeichen ausreichen, um Lesbarkeit zu gewährleisten.

Beispiel 3: Tabellenzellen mit konsistentem Abstand

In Tabellen können   oder   verwendet werden, um Spaltenoptik zu verbessern, insbesondere in Kopfzeilen, die sich prospiziert abheben sollen. Achten Sie darauf, die Abstände konsistent zu halten, damit die Tabelle nicht unruhig wirkt.

Beispiel 4: Mathematische Formeln

In mathematischen Kontexten kann ein thin space zwischen Operatoren und Zahlen sinnvoll sein, z. B. 3 × 106 m/s, wobei der Abstand zwischen Zahl, Einheiten und Operatoren die Lesbarkeit erhöht.

Barrierefreiheit und HTML Leerzeichen: Lesbarkeit für alle verbessern

Barrierefreiheit bedeutet, Inhalte so bereitzustellen, dass Menschen mit unterschiedlichen Fähigkeiten sie gut nutzen können. HTML Leerzeichen spielen dabei eine Rolle, wenn sie das Textverständnis unterstützen. Vermeiden Sie übermäßige Spezialzeichen in Abschnitten, die Screenreader vorlesen. Nutzt man korrekt gesetzte HTML-Elemente in Kombination mit sinnvollen Abständen und semantischen Strukturen, verbessert sich die Zugänglichkeit deutlich. Denken Sie daran, dass HTML Leerzeichen in Überschriften, Absätzen und Listen durch klare Semantik unterstützt werden sollten, um eine bessere Orientierung zu ermöglichen.

HTML Leerzeichen in unterschiedlichen Kontexten: Responsive Design und Mehrsprachigkeit

In responsive Designs ändert sich das Layout mit der Fensterbreite. Was in einer großen Desktop-Ansicht gut aussieht, kann auf mobilen Geräten zu Bruch gehen, wenn HTML Leerzeichen unbedacht eingesetzt wurden. Verwenden Sie daher flexible Layout-Strategien in Kombination mit passenden Abständen, statt ausschließlich auf vordefinierte Entitäten zu setzen. In mehrsprachigen Seiten muss bei der Verwendung von HTML Leerzeichen die typografische Praxis der jeweiligen Sprache beachtet werden. Manche Sprachen nutzen mehr Spacing zwischen Wörtern, andere weniger. Eine gute Praxis ist, Übersetzungen in einem Content-Management-System so zu strukturieren, dass der Textfluss natürlich bleibt und HTML Leerzeichen nicht die Lesbarkeit beeinträchtigen.

Best Practices: Eine robuste Strategie für HTML Leerzeichen

  1. Verwenden Sie HTML Leerzeichen gezielt dort, wo sie wirklich den Textfluss verbessern oder Zusammengehörigkeiten visuell unterstützen.
  2. Begrenzen Sie den Einsatz von   auf notwendige Fälle, um ungewollte Umbrüche zu vermeiden.
  3. Testen Sie die Darstellung in unterschiedlichen Browsern und Geräten, insbesondere bei Tabellen, Überschriften und langen Textblöcken.
  4. Nutzen Sie CSS, um Abstände konsistent zu gestalten und die semantische Struktur der Inhalte zu bewahren.

Suchmaschinenfreundliche Struktur: HTML Leerzeichen sinnvoll in die Seitenarchitektur integrieren

Eine suchmaschinenfreundliche Seite zeichnet sich durch klare Überschriften-Hierarchie, verständliche Absätze und eine konsistente Formatierung aus. HTML Leerzeichen unterstützen dieses Ziel, wenn sie sinnvoll und sparsam eingesetzt werden. Vermeiden Sie Keyword-Stuffing. Stattdessen sollten Sie den Fokus auf informative Inhalte, klare Gliederung und nutzerfreundliche Typografie legen. Wenn Sie den Fokus auf das Keyword HTML Leerzeichen legen, platzieren Sie das Konzept organisch in den Absätzen, in den Überschriften und in erklärenden Listen.

Inferenzen, Mythen und Missverständnisse rund um HTML Leerzeichen

Es gibt Missverständnisse darüber, ob HTML Leerzeichen die Ladezeiten beeinflussen oder ob man sie überhaupt in HTML5 noch verwenden sollte. Die Realität ist, dass korrekt eingesetzte HTML Leerzeichen keinen messbaren negativen Einfluss auf die Performance haben. Vielmehr kommt es auf die Gesamtkonzeption an: Strukturiertes HTML, saubere Semantik, sinnvoller Einsatz von Entitäten und eine überlegte CSS-Strategie.HTML Leerzeichen sind ein Werkzeug des Entwicklers, kein Ersatz für saubere Code-Strukturen.

Fazit: HTML Leerzeichen gezielt einsetzen, für bessere Lesbarkeit und saubere Struktur

HTML Leerzeichen bieten eine Reihe von Möglichkeiten, Textfluss, Layout und Lesbarkeit zu optimieren. Vom normalen Leerzeichen bis hin zu Non-breaking Spaces und typografischen Entitäten wie   und   – jedes Element hat seinen Platz in der richtigen Situation. Indem Sie HTML Leerzeichen bewusst verwenden und mit CSS kombinieren, schaffen Sie Inhalte, die sowohl für Benutzer als auch für Suchmaschinen klar verständlich sind. Denken Sie daran, dass der Schlüssel zu guter Web-Text-Qualität eine ausgewogene Balance zwischen Darstellungspräzision, Lesbarkeit und Barrierefreiheit ist. HTML Leerzeichen sind dabei ein unverzichtbares Werkzeug in Ihrem Toolkit, das Ihnen hilft, Texte effektiv zu strukturieren und Inhalte ansprechend zu präsentieren.

Zusammenfassung der wichtigsten Konzepte zu HTML Leerzeichen

Zusammenfassend lässt sich sagen, dass HTML Leerzeichen die Art und Weise beeinflussen, wie Texte in Webseiten gerendert werden. Die Kernpunkte sind:

  • Normale Leerzeichen dienen dem normalen Textfluss, doch HTML ignoriert mehrere aufeinanderfolgende Leerzeichen standardmäßig.
  • Non-breaking Space und andere Entitäten ermöglichen kontrollierte Trennbarkeit und Abstände in Texten.
  • CSS white-space bietet zusätzliche Kontrolle über Zeilenumbrüche und Abstände.
  • SEO und Barrierefreiheit profitieren von einer klaren Struktur und einem bedachten Einsatz von HTML Leerzeichen.

Indem Sie HTML Leerzeichen klug einsetzen, verbessern Sie die Verständlichkeit, Lesbarkeit und Stabilität Ihrer Webseiten. Ob Sie nun einfache Textblöcke formatieren, Tabellen sauber ausrichten oder komplexe Layouts konsistent gestalten möchten – dieses Wissen hilft Ihnen, kompetent zu arbeiten und Ihre Inhalte auf hohem Niveau zu präsentieren.